Changes to the assessment of need process for children and families in Cavan is needed to tackle wait times.
That's according to local senator Joe O'Reilly who said new targeted reforms aimed at improving the Assessment of Need process for children and their families should reduce the waitlist.
The Fine Gael man said too many families have been waiting far too long for assessments and these reforms will help tackle the backlog.
Some of the new key measurements include new support teams, a single point of access system, and the autism assessment and intervention protocol.
